ALPHONSE MUCHA (1860-1939) [THE SEASONS.] Group of four decorative panels. 1896.
Each 37 3/4x19 1/2 inches, 96x49 1/2 cm.
Condition varies, generally B+ / B: minor abrasions and losses at edges; staining in image. Mounted on board.
"One of Mucha's most endearing and enduring sets. The idea of personifying the four seasons was nothing new . . . but Mucha breathed so much more life into it that this became one of the best selling sets of decorative panels" (Rennert / Weill p. 90). "Mucha's style of [this] time was characterized by brooding, melancholic figures, strong theatrical poses, and flowing robes that at the same time hide and reveal beautiful female bodies whose figures are outlined by bold decorative line" (Spirit of Art Nouveau p. 184). Rennert / Weill 18, Lendl 54, Mucha P3, Spirit of Art Nouveau 44.
